
- •Практическая работа 2 Документы (Создание, Настройка, Проверка)
- •5. Напоминание:
- •6. Порядок выполнения работы.
- •7. Теоретическая часть Документы
- •7.1. Общие сведения
- •7.2. Свойства последовательности документов
- •7.3. Работа с последовательностями документов
- •7.4. Свойства документа
- •7.5. Модули
- •7.6. Журналы документов
- •8.1.3. Проверка работы созданной конфигурации в режиме 1с:Предприятие.
- •8.2. Документ «Заказ»
- •8.2.1. Создание журнала документов «Заказ»
- •8.2.2 Создание документа «Заказ»
- •8.2.3. Проверка работы с документом «Заказ»
- •8.3. Документ «Счет»
- •8.3.2 Создание документа «Счет»
- •8.4.3. Проверка работы с документом «Расходная Накладная»
- •Журналы Документов
- •Настройка Журнала Документов «Товары»
- •Содержание отчета
- •1) Цель работы
- •2) Условия работы
- •Контрольные вопросы
7.6. Журналы документов
В системе 1С:Предприятие журналы являются средством для работы с документами. Работая с журналом, пользователь может вводить документы, просматривать их, редактировать и удалять. Журналы позволяют группировать документы для просмотра и быстрого доступа к ним.
Конфигуратор позволяет создавать любое количество журналов.
При создании любого журнала для него создается экранная форма в виде таблицы, содержащей графы для отображения реквизитов документов. Для журнала может быть задано произвольное количество граф для отображения значений любых реквизитов документов из числа доступных в этом журнале.
Журналы документов в системе 1С:Предприятие представляют пользователю развитые средства для работы с документами. Помимо операций, уже упоминавшихся выше, пользователь может искать любой документ в журнале по содержимому граф, выполнять поиск документов по их номерам.
В системе 1С:Предприятие процессы создания журналов и размещение документов по конкретным журналам тесно связаны между собой.
8. Описание выполнения работы
8.1. Документ «Поступление Товара»
8.1.1. Создание журнала документов «Товары»
Выполняется с помощью конструктора.
Для этого откроем окно «Конфигурация», выделим в ней строку «Журналы документов» и щелкнем по кнопке «Добавить» в панели инструментов этого окна.
Откроется окно конструктора журналов документов, в первом окне которого надо ввести имя и синоним «Товары». Окно конструктора журнала пока закроем, т.к. еще не созданы документы.
8.1.2. Создание документа «Поступление Товара»
В дереве конфигурации выделим ветвь «Документы» -> по кнопке «Добавить» -> откроется окно конструктора:
1) Закладка «Основные» - заполним поля ввода имени (Поступление Товара) и синонима.
2) Закладка «Данные» - внесем пять реквизитов документа:
Реквизит шапки – «Поставщик» (В верхней части окна -> «Добавить» -> ,Появится палитра свойств для этого реквизита (справа), в которой надо внести имя реквизита (Поставщик) и выбрать тип данных – СправочникСсылка.Контрагенты.
Добавления реквизитов табличной части. Реквизиты табличной части «Товар», «Количество», «Цена», «Сумма». Для добавления реквизитов табличной части надо сначала создать табличную часть (их может быть несколько) с помощью кнопки «Добавить табличную часть» и указать ее имя – Товары. Затем – по кнопке «Добавить реквизит»:
Внесем в палитре свойств имя реквизита «Товар» и выберем тип данных – СправочникСсылка.Номенклатура.
Добавим ревизит «Количество» и выберем тип «Число», включим опцию – «Неотрицательный».
Добавим реквизит «Цена» и выберем тип «Число», точность – 2, включим опцию – «Неотрицательный».
Добавим реквизит «Сумма» и выберем тип «Число», точность – 2, включим опцию – «Неотрицательный».
2) На закладке «Нумерация» установим периодичность – «в пределах года»
3) На закладке «Журналы» установим, что документ регистрируется в журнале «Товары» (пометим галочкой нужный журнал).
4) На закладке «Формы» создадим форму списка и выбора. С помощью кнопки «Добавить» откроется первое окно «Конструктора формы документа», где надо включить опцию «Основная форма списка и выбора». Во втором окне укажем реквизиты: Картинка, Дата, Номер, Поставщик. -> «Готово» -> закроем форму.
Создадим форму документа. С помощью кнопки «Добавить» откроется первое окно конструктора, где установим переключатель «Форма документа». Во втором окне укажем реквизиты шапки (Дата, Номер, Поставщик) и реквизиты табличной части (НомерСтроки, Товар, Количество, Цена, Сумма) -> кнопка «Готово».
5) Далее откроется форма документа. В которой поля «Номер» и «Дата» можно сузить.
6) В закладке «Модуль» введем процедуру:
Процедура ПриВводеИИзменении(Элемент)
//Рассчитать сумму в табличной части.
СтрокаТЧ = ЭлементыФормы.Товары.ТекущиеДанные;
СтрокаТЧ.Сумма = СтрокаТЧ.Цена * СтрокаТЧ.Количество;
КонецПроцедуры
Данная процедура предназначена для расчета суммы по количеству и цене.
7) После добавления процедуры в закладке «Модуль» надо перейти к закладке «Диалог». В этом окне надо дважды щелкнуть по полю ввода в столбце «Количество» и в открывшемся справа окне палитре свойств найти группу свойств «События» и в поле «При изменении» выбрать в списке созданную процедуру ПриВводеИИзменении.
Тоже самое проделать для поля ввода в столбце «Цена».
Таким образом, в столбце «Сумма» значение будет пересчитываться при вводе или изменении, как значения «Количество», так и значения «Цена».
Закроем форму документа и окно конструктора.